Advertisement

上位机与下位机的温湿度实时监控系统

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目设计了一套基于上位机和下位机的温湿度实时监控系统,能够精准监测并记录环境数据,确保适宜的存储或工作条件。 温湿度实时监测系统包括VB上位机和C下位机。51单片机实时读取温湿度传感器数据并通过串口发送给计算机,上位机则实时显示这些数据。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 湿
    优质
    本项目设计了一套基于上位机和下位机的温湿度实时监控系统,能够精准监测并记录环境数据,确保适宜的存储或工作条件。 温湿度实时监测系统包括VB上位机和C下位机。51单片机实时读取温湿度传感器数据并通过串口发送给计算机,上位机则实时显示这些数据。
  • 湿
    优质
    温湿度监控系统上位机是一款用于实时监测与控制环境温湿度的专业软件。它能够接收并处理下位机(传感器)传输的数据,确保存储或生产环境维持在适宜条件下。 本代码实现了无线自组网监测系统的上位机功能。它能够从USB串口接收硬件传输的数据,并对数据进行处理和展示,通过折线图的形式动态展现出来并保存到SQL Server数据库中。折线图的绘制使用了开源C#类库ZedGraph。
  • 湿
    优质
    温湿度监控系统上位机是一款用于监测与控制环境温湿度的专业软件或硬件平台,能够实时采集、分析并记录数据,确保存储或生产环境中温湿度符合标准要求。 本代码实现了无线自组网监测系统的上位机功能,能够从USB串口接收硬件传输的数据,并对其进行处理。数据的动态展示采用折线图的方式呈现,使用的开源C#类库是ZedGraph。此外,系统还将数据保存到SQL Server数据库中。
  • 湿
    优质
    温湿度监测系统上位机是用于监控环境中的温度和湿度变化的专业软件或设备控制终端。通过它,用户可以实时查看数据、设置报警阈值并长期记录存储监测信息,确保环境条件符合要求。 Android上位机通过WiFi连接上下位机,可以实时检测下位机的温湿度数据,并可设置温度和湿度报警阈值。
  • C#湿
    优质
    C#上位机温湿度监测项目是一款采用C#编程语言开发的应用程序,能够实时采集并显示环境中的温度和湿度数据,为用户提供直观的数据分析与监控界面。 本软件基于 .NET 框架(C#),在 Visual Studio 2017 上开发,具有以下特性: 本软件仅供学习和测试使用,禁止二次销售。 功能包括: - 串口设置:波特率、串口号、停止位等。 - 串口收发功能。 - 生成指定范围内的随机测试数据,并以 txt 格式保存(格式为 x,y\r\n,其中 x 表示时间(小时),y 表示湿度(百分比))。 - 对形如 x,y\r\n 的文件进行绘图处理;若不符合该格式,则不执行绘图操作。
  • 调试程序
    优质
    本项目专注于开发和调试用于温度监控系统的上位机与下位机软件。通过优化通讯协议及算法提升系统精度与稳定性。 《温度监测系统开发详解——基于WinForm C#的上位机与下位机协同调试》 在现代工业生产环境中,有效的温度监控是确保设备安全高效运行的关键因素之一。本项目“温度监测上位机+下位机调试程序”提供了一套全面的解决方案,通过实时采集并展示由下位机构件获得的数据,并且能够在出现异常时即时报警。接下来我们将详细探讨该系统的组成、工作原理以及开发过程中所涉及的核心技术。 一、系统架构 此系统主要分为两部分:上位机和下位机。 1. 上位机采用Windows Forms (WinForm) 开发,使用C#语言编写,并具备友好的用户界面。它能够实时展示温度曲线图,允许用户设定温度上限与下限值,并在超出预设范围时触发报警机制。 2. 下位机通常为嵌入式系统或单片机类型设备,负责采集和初步处理来自温度传感器的数据,然后通过串行通信协议(如RS-485 或 UART)将数据传输至上位机进行进一步分析与展示。 二、关键功能实现 1. 实时温度显示:上位机会定期从下位机获取当前的温度数值,并利用定时器控件更新曲线图以动态地展现温度变化情况。为了绘制这些图表,可以使用GDI+库或第三方Chart控件等工具。 2. 温度上下限设置:用户可以在界面上输入预设的阈值范围,系统会根据设定进行判断,在实际测量结果超出预定区间时自动触发报警提示信息。 3. 报警机制:一旦检测到温度异常情况发生,上位机会同时发出声音警告和视觉指示来提醒操作人员注意潜在问题。 三、通信协议 为了保证数据的准确传输,本项目采用了RS-485串行通讯标准。该协议支持多主站网络配置,并具有较强的抗干扰能力,在远程环境中表现尤为出色。 四、调试程序 下位机调试软件用于检验硬件接口和通信协议的有效性,它能够模拟温度读取过程来检查与上位机之间的连接是否正常工作以及数据格式是否正确。在项目开发阶段,此工具对于优化系统性能至关重要。 五、开发环境与工具 本项目的编码及测试均使用Visual Studio 2015作为集成开发环境(IDE),它提供了一个强大的平台支持C#语言的编写和调试功能。 综上所述,“温度监测上位机+下位机调试程序”是一个典型的工业自动化监控案例,涵盖了软件编程、硬件接口设计以及通信协议等多个技术领域。通过深入了解该系统的运作机制,开发者可以更好地掌握类似项目的开发技巧并提高工作效率。
  • DHT11液晶湿显示+VB.rar
    优质
    本项目为一个结合了DHT11温湿度传感器和液晶显示屏的硬件系统,能够实时监测并展示环境中的温度与湿度信息。同时通过Visual Basic开发的上位机软件实现远程监控功能,便于用户在电脑端查看数据。整个设计适用于家庭、办公室等场景下的环境参数检测需求。 使用52单片机结合DHT11温湿度传感器,并通过C02检测模块收集数据。将这些实时的温湿度数据显示在1602A液晶屏上,同时利用VB软件作为上位机进行同步显示。
  • 基于LabVIEW智能湿通信制响应
    优质
    本项目设计了一套基于LabVIEW的智能温湿度监控系统,实现了上位机和下位机之间的有效通信及实时控制响应机制。通过该系统,可以高效、精确地完成环境温湿度数据采集、分析与调控。 基于LabVIEW的智能温湿度监测系统能够对环境进行有效监控,并通过上下位机之间的通信机制实现数据实时传输与准确控制。 上位机负责采集由下位机发送来的温湿度信息,利用内置程序模块分析这些数据是否超出预设范围。一旦检测到异常情况(即温度或湿度值超限),上位机会根据预先设定的逻辑向对应的下位机发出指令以启动加热或者加湿设备。 作为嵌入式系统,下位机的任务是采集环境中的温湿度信息并通过串行接口将这些数据发送给上位机。同时,它还能接收到来自上位机的操作命令,并据此调控相应的硬件设施来调整室内的温度与湿度水平至理想状态。 为了确保系统的实时响应能力,整个通信过程必须具备高度的稳定性和效率。这不仅要求上下位机之间有快速的数据传输通道,还意味着控制指令应能迅速被执行以保证环境调节的有效性。在设计阶段需要特别注意选择高效的数据处理算法和优化后的通讯协议来达成这一目标。 LabVIEW为开发者提供了大量的库函数以及模块化的编程方式,使得构建具备监测、调控及通信功能的完整应用程序变得简单快捷。其图形化界面简化了复杂逻辑的设计过程,无需编写大量代码即可完成项目开发工作。 温湿度监控系统在农业种植、仓库管理、精密制造车间乃至数据中心和智能家居等多个领域均有着广泛的应用前景。准确地控制环境条件对于保证产品质量、提升工作效率以及维护人员健康等方面至关重要。 设计这样一套系统的工程师需要考虑包括硬件配置选择,传感器的精度要求,通信连接的稳定性及用户界面友好度在内的诸多因素。此外,系统的设计还应具备良好的扩展性与易于操作的特点以适应未来可能的需求变化和技术升级。 总而言之,基于LabVIEW构建的智能温湿度监测系统通过上下位机的有效配合实现了对环境条件的精准监控和灵活调节功能,适用于各种不同场景的应用需求。在开发过程中需同时关注软件及硬件层面的设计细节,确保系统的整体性能与可靠性达到最佳状态。
  • C#湿计数据
    优质
    本系统为C#开发的温湿度监控软件,专为下位机设计。能够实时采集环境中的温度和湿度数据,并进行统计分析,支持数据显示、记录保存及异常报警功能。 在现代科技快速发展的背景下,环境监控变得越来越重要,在工业、农业及医疗等领域发挥着关键作用。本段落将深入探讨一个基于C#语言开发的下位机温湿度显示监控统计系统,旨在帮助用户实时了解并记录环境中的温度和湿度变化,并为决策提供数据支持。 C#是由微软开发的一种面向对象编程语言,广泛应用于Windows平台的应用程序开发中。在这个系统里,C#作为主要的开发工具被使用,凭借其强大的.NET框架和支持丰富的类库功能,能够方便地实现与硬件设备的数据交互、处理通信以及构建用户友好的图形界面。 该系统的其中一个核心功能是接收下位机无线传送来的温度和湿度数据。下位机通常指的是连接到传感器并负责采集数据的微控制器设备,它们通过无线通信协议(例如Wi-Fi、蓝牙或Zigbee)将收集的数据发送至上位机,即运行监控系统程序的计算机上。在C#中,开发者可以使用串行通信库(如SerialPort类)来建立与下位机之间的连接,并接收和解析这些数据。 对于数据显示方面,该系统可能采用GUI设计方法,利用Windows Forms或WPF框架创建一个能够实时更新显示的数据界面。用户可以看到清晰的温度和湿度读数,这些数据可以以数字形式或者模拟表盘的形式展示出来,确保信息易于理解与查看。 此外,该系统还具备统计历史温湿度数据的功能。这意味着它需要有存储和处理数据的能力,在C#中可以通过ADO.NET接口访问数据库(例如SQL Server或SQLite)来实现这一功能,将接收到的每个数据点都保存下来,并按时间戳排序后存入表格内。 进一步地,系统可能利用绘图库如System.Drawing或者更专业的图表组件DevExpress、Telerik等绘制温度和湿度的历史曲线图。这样用户不仅能查看当前数值,还能通过这些图表直观了解随时间变化的趋势情况,从而发现潜在规律或异常现象。 总结来说,C#下位机温湿度显示监控统计系统利用了C#的强大功能实现了与下位机的无线通信、实时数据展示、历史数据分析以及可视化分析。这样的系统对提高环境监测效率和准确性具有显著价值,在需要实时监测及长期追踪温度变化的应用场景中尤为适用。通过不断优化和完善,该系统能够更好地服务于各种环境监控需求。
  • 基于C#湿源码
    优质
    本项目提供了一个用C#编写的温湿度监控软件源代码,适用于开发人员构建和自定义自己的温湿度监测系统。此源码可用于教育、研究或实际应用场景中,帮助用户实现数据采集与分析功能。 基于C#的温湿度上位机源码;代码结构清晰,适合初学者。